Wilmslow Train Station is well-equipped with facilities designed to make your travel experience smooth and hassle-free. The ticket office operates from early morning until late evening, from 6 AM to 8 PM during weekdays and slightly shorter hours on Saturdays. Even when the ticket office is closed, numerous ticket machines accept both cash and cards, providing flexible options for ticket collection, including tickets purchased online. The station supports accessibility with step-free access throughout and accessible ticket machines.
For those needing assistance, though there is no staff help available on site, the helpline at 08002006060 is available for guidance. CCTV cameras ensure safety, while a small coffee shop adjacent to the station entrance offers refreshments for your journey.
Cyclists will find bicycle stands opposite the station building, though shelter and hire services aren’t available. Those driving to the station will find a car park managed by Northern, available 24 hours a day with ample parking spaces, including accessible options for disabled badge holders. However, note the specific parking charges if you plan on leaving your vehicle there for more than a couple of hours.
The station provides robust connections to other transport modes, including bus services and taxis. The local taxi service is available, facilitating easy access to various parts of the town and surrounding areas. For those looking to explore further by bus, you can get more details by contacting the Busline at 0871 200 2233. While there's mention of a rail replacement service via the Short Stay Car Park, it appears bicycle hire is currently unavailable.

The station is equipped with a ticket office, though its opening hours are limited to weekdays from 06:20 to 09:05. For convenience, ticket machines are available all the time, where you can also collect tickets bought online. Accessible ticket machines cater to travelers with a Disabled Persons Railcard, ensuring an inclusive travel experience.
While Micheldever station may not boast a wide range of amenities, it offers the essentials such as bicycle storage with racks and lockers, and pay phones available for use. Unfortunately, there are no ref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, so prepare ahead and plan accordingly.
Accessibility is a key consideration at Micheldever station, with an induction loop facility, an accessible ticket machine, and a ramp for train access. However, it's important to note that the station has a step-free category C designation, meaning it does not offer complete step-free access. For travelers requiring assistance, the guard on board the train provides assistance for boarding and alighting trains, and you can book assistance up to two hours before your journey.
